From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 0A5EBCE8379 for ; Mon, 30 Sep 2024 19:00:22 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 5E81C280020; Mon, 30 Sep 2024 15:00:22 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 570E2280017; Mon, 30 Sep 2024 15:00:22 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 41221280020; Mon, 30 Sep 2024 15:00:22 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0012.hostedemail.com [216.40.44.12]) by kanga.kvack.org (Postfix) with ESMTP id 216C1280017 for ; Mon, 30 Sep 2024 15:00:22 -0400 (EDT) Received: from smtpin18.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ay08.hostedemail.com (Postfix) with ESMTP id 9DA461405B6 for ; Mon, 30 Sep 2024 19:00:21 +0000 (UTC) X-FDA: 82622320242.18.F34B702 Received: from mail-pf1-f181.google.com (mail-pf1-f181.google.com [209.85.210.181]) by imf04.hostedemail.com (Postfix) with ESMTP id A511040029 for ; Mon, 30 Sep 2024 19:00:19 +0000 (UTC) Authentication-Results: imf04.hostedemail.com; dkim=pass header.d=osandov-com.20230601.gappssmtp.com header.s=20230601 header.b=ZxlLOGOl; spf=none (imf04.hostedemail.com: domain of osandov@osandov.com has no SPF policy when checking 209.85.210.181) smtp.mailfrom=osandov@osandov.com; dmarc=none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1727722693;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=tK4zHMv9BgdsXfJFkQFkyqT5Q9MVxMalN7pOJK+VYMc=; b=rXxrUtR1xpPY28qzrafNP8FXVHcHT5bid5Wg/SnJEMBQmvKQYvUQ7Ny7VY+6wmMK1tNahZ FHbPLmR9uO4jmsaP7I86Z1t9VuF5ZAKHQEwzhFB0dAzz/Qlk1Gmej2qrX8+XzDxx0BPz9I HT9RUgQ7OMkv5NQMR7xsVrOQFNymvzs= 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1727722693; a=rsa-sha256; cv=none; b=MMpRKa3EiJPh/PC0EQ7+FQvgFQbNNBjB/qqbgPRuFpfj2/poK+duo0oQ2xETCG+6wB4emm btg8qSiGtdandcTYWYjwEMqHnjgsqRIL6nPf4rpiaM1oj4DjjiaZMutwuSbq9dWidTyJAT T1HFVU2Lv6oYe0znk1Kqo2v1u9dUCQY= ARC-Authentication-Results: i=1; imf04.hostedemail.com; dkim=pass header.d=osandov-com.20230601.gappssmtp.com header.s=20230601 header.b=ZxlLOGOl; spf=none (imf04.hostedemail.com: domain of osandov@osandov.com has no SPF policy when checking 209.85.210.181) smtp.mailfrom=osandov@osandov.com; dmarc=none Received: by mail-pf1-f181.google.com with SMTP id d2e1a72fcca58-71790698b22so645260b3a.1 for ; Mon, 30 Sep 2024 12:00:19 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=osandov-com.20230601.gappssmtp.com; s=20230601; t=1727722818; x=1728327618; darn=kvack.org;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:from:to:cc:subject:date:message-id:reply-to; bh=tK4zHMv9BgdsXfJFkQFkyqT5Q9MVxMalN7pOJK+VYMc=; b=ZxlLOGOlDdUnJl9r885M4UULQOr/5pzrlEMBYeXqxLCMMt18/QHL1m6cJonH33wbgE z+O1QLxZzUuaA4uWxFAOWglX51uPjEIfFH3epQ1c7CCWsLXFE3AdGd+Z16UDp8O8mQNK o7XoLlAERMnLON0ybDzFRUryfIDnPFBYjG9jXhOnmn6xlFibgZceQ/JZHgUQM2ObI4oB TBm+rFlxtKimitHFXenQ3xJQUI5CdWMkHUm1BmAEJ/G4SPTiyk7Lcm3LDLUXnRpsFh8q arrechVCgXa2uuofj+1lHbsMU/76a689OwI2t4Zdls/jYjspIiNf6qnFtFgNwLYIgOqf eKbg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1727722818; x=1728327618; h=in-reply-to:content-disposition:mime-version:references:message-id :subject:cc:to:from:date: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=tK4zHMv9BgdsXfJFkQFkyqT5Q9MVxMalN7pOJK+VYMc=; b=ek6Tbuhrq7ov/c2YhdTkRwg3qxSDkNBrFt0YGOwLR6qejPwp0UJowjmTWBulRO+Au1 WL3s0zJMh1DTT7qK8ZwIUCTAb3h7E6UdFaOBkqibukbj1+tafD+rZ+Kcl8Xt9wj96+3Q w4f15rhswjtagO4C5SF+t0e/03U+UwEcDK27gyyoKnqU1gx8EyVgCCdK1VJxtPmgs6qQ Br9M7ONOdaqeEPr5l5GNwh33QLfnJdDiSgYwMyw2ip2DrLejziXdcZIIBoeJA7HcHeyn nYbAR1Wq3ZNcVx1Z2gixQ6Q8B1gV9UZuOmArgnyYGuS20OMGsOYlmxOYWR5mp0i1pb4A VbxA== X-Forwarded-Encrypted: i=1; AJvYcCU4BqBx3JL+gr4gZqVsPq7EBc9u5nHq7flzKd1WxtTSJzRZZZzuxUVjbR9Iw+Io9hwLMIRQXIubKQ==@kvack.org X-Gm-Message-State: AOJu0Yyc4wdnLRUCXjY8bz7U9gnTM7ucrcf8nTmN3Q6ongghJ0MthWtv d+7ws/689B2o5UkX+9A0EvhBGnVa7svdVyx4YUxRBiectEjo3puAHcQM56aLqtc= X-Google-Smtp-Source: AGHT+IHr3t4octArrJkwK4KlggdiRYNEixY4E7CvOHzMJxxuBtEfGjyLTrjjT9DROP00qxEU234jog== X-Received: by 2002:a05:6a00:2392:b0:718:e49f:246e with SMTP id d2e1a72fcca58-71b260a8a3fmr8397735b3a.6.1727722818090; Mon, 30 Sep 2024 12:00:18 -0700 (PDT) Received: from telecaster.dhcp.thefacebook.com ([2620:10d:c090:500::6:e49b]) by smtp.gmail.com with ESMTPSA id d2e1a72fcca58-71b2652a622sm6544654b3a.164.2024.09.30.12.00.15 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 30 Sep 2024 12:00:17 -0700 (PDT) Date: Mon, 30 Sep 2024 12:00:13 -0700 From: Omar Sandoval To: David Howells Cc: Eduard Zingerman , Leon Romanovsky , Christian Brauner , Manu Bretelle , asmadeus@codewreck.org, ceph-devel@vger.kernel.org, christian@brauner.io, ericvh@kernel.org, hsiangkao@linux.alibaba.com, idryomov@gmail.com, jlayton@kernel.org, linux-afs@lists.infradead.org, linux-cifs@vger.kernel.org, linux-erofs@lists.ozlabs.org, linux-fsdevel@vger.kernel.org, linux-kernel@vger.kernel.org, linux-mm@kvack.org, linux-nfs@vger.kernel.org, marc.dionne@auristor.com, netdev@vger.kernel.org, netfs@lists.linux.dev, pc@manguebit.com, smfrench@gmail.com, sprasad@microsoft.com, tom@talpey.com, v9fs@lists.linux.dev, willy@infradead.org Subject: Re: [PATCH v2 19/25] netfs: Speed up buffered reading Message-ID: References: <423fbd9101dab18ba772f24db4ab2fecf5de2261.camel@gmail.com> <2968940.1727700270@warthog.procyon.org.uk> <20240925103118.GE967758@unreal> <20240923183432.1876750-1-chantr4@gmail.com> <20240814203850.2240469-20-dhowells@redhat.com> <1279816.1727220013@warthog.procyon.org.uk> <4b5621958a758da830c1cf09c6f6893aed371f9d.camel@gmail.com> <2969660.1727700717@warthog.procyon.org.uk> <3007428.1727721302@warthog.procyon.org.uk>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<3007428.1727721302@warthog.procyon.org.uk> X-Stat-Signature: na96mf8fn5iqadc9pq5szsj1uy1cxztp X-Rspamd-Queue-Id: A511040029 X-Rspam-User: X-Rspamd-Server: rspam08 X-HE-Tag: 1727722819-93669 X-HE-Meta: U2FsdGVkX1+PvzhignVVQVXoSpiOlDcaNEu3y5wC8eF1gB1icKl752sIbGsJmA5wEpVWREY7rJ33rYoyWC0+/7AG03fJFGmJi64zhVhWA+91fo57cOs/xC0WC+PxJeclgSEtLuHoLnkaHF1zoNVv2viQpkZsSwknDwgg8wGK3hH0cNKq5B911zwVSjMBkTGoKiW17ZQH+uZBbElLimD9OVlrlDWTng7PRO3e3F5xhoGjEt9ZOJxH56ugCUB4e4tFRS7saIJYbioix5sUaYEcjjv41eZfarQE41k1Q61WAJABDoyZ8bcZmZne3IoiGAJpcrWKOWTf4ClfwbCuz6heiDMNHF+SgXxKrmsw50yTedCLNLpupug1O2oW8myD4DuZQz/wxUiTE1CzJE+CPixGm/oNCPeBlNVIzU+JKkyhUHpxagb6LDvotgmm5k0WYcWEOQIgKP2A/2hfmdf9M3bopBb6DybsG/2s04xXu3w+YAht2IVSptiFLDvh459Ui1SoZs+A3Dr0YH2JtbCmuy5othJTwHcUEHEKDs72CeMBXveAwMJGlDF4dys3JvrhbuXMrsCHP3U8cU9Fs5ZK/wDE24McnVDVA+SDt1LybcmbNbr7viktDjBVdNtLAumO4E11/nZGPHOU/SyC07UWGnlhZzsgxSDcxIhTRf+sgoCJsn21OKInDvpvb8J4g2erqBiOslEW933WzMkcFfKhi8gkHCYu7JvA7YOPwu7qOUGaUM2kyGImpIA5GeLDlkKNgNbTFbkQVITGCBY5B/zFM3JtAa6xHJqYPV/rnZ4Y9Kfe7amUVJa6qsOu4fygcsN55O9xInNvFlGvESsjpO6pzrEB5Yeef9iVkwNL9G5kLxkURoVueZmx9ee5CP6PvHE8eftTtOkG8aUWec5orGyg9Y5JtYWKwke22WEpXxVnnFkev3kM4rk4LCMUGpLOcsU/ePudvkXocfL2ZvWI8u6Ix7r 3bnFfDQq vpG0IbvaDeLQB5abOWA8o7FmiCCx3uml8v/8ssEazqh58Jq4luQ6x7nk2zLnbiaKB0fFcHaMR300QXnVBIY5moDmD6dzokN09eXkX/ddqe4iEEcBl95sZMtAYU/7w57pUKRGgS6kRDD5BQq7EeCCrfSQbnkjPFTuE+XyNSgZ1ejONjkCWN0bPHpYNW9DcceyKA6nwMLPNIshAhVbEW/Y0nW0sWq8KeIPodJWAqf+ggaUG+isx5sj7zTWZMNkySLNqhBH133eVOK+ozrSqvPEjN+9t+cO+zuY1OBdtdb8/smi1LzYYfkYG9WHJd53kbeG5O0Esy4dXrNHvaZEApBLmbo+qUqoLENh6T+rVmwp/wzo5dwFqYHiE8IAY5E6X0CMQLm+phoGOxrf2SBHQBKwREPTtiwAfjR7/wcHTJa1KiVJ6rMpjBD4C1PsRb6UI3Fn5DhbqAGpXUTodQghuIvwOBM65FlLBSw57/olidGibVP8lo9w= X-Bogosity: Ham, tests=bogofilter, spamicity=0.219586,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Mon, Sep 30, 2024 at 07:35:02PM +0100, David Howells wrote: > Eduard Zingerman wrote: > > > Are there any hacks possible to printout tracelog before complete boot > > somehow? > > You could try setting CONFIG_NETFS_DEBUG=y. That'll print some stuff to > dmesg. > > David I hit this in drgn's VM test setup, too, and just sent a patch that fixed it for me and Manu: https://lore.kernel.org/linux-fsdevel/cbaf141ba6c0e2e209717d02746584072844841a.1727722269.git.osandov@fb.com/ Thanks, Omar